This Sunday: Jehovah-m’Kaddesh, “The Lord Who Sanctifies” Sometimes in our Christian journey, we seem to drift here and wander there, not really knowing God’s plans for us. We realize there is a possibility of having a deeper relationship with God, we know about and have been baptized by the Holy Spirit, but there seems to be no growth or hunger for growth. How can this happen? It happens because there is something lacking, and the key is in the name Jehovah m’Kaddesh. This name does not fall trippingly off tongue and may be unfamiliar, but it means “The Lord Who Sanctifies.” The verb “to sanctify” means “to consecrate, dedicate, or to become holy.” On Sunday, we will look at how God’s sanctifying grace helps us live the life God intends for us to live.
